Handing off the Quillbus broker upgrade (4.x to 5.1) to Dario. Cluster is half-migrated; mixed-version mode is supported but TLS cert rotation must finish before cutover. No auth model changes, though the admin API gained two new endpoints worth reviewing. Open questions and the migration checklist are tracked on the internal page below.

dashboard of taduf-bawef = https://jira.lumicsys.internal/projects/display/browse/b1cbf89d

Ticket: FIELD-2281 — Expired credentials blocking offline sync

For the weekly sync: the Heronpath field-survey app's offline mode stopped reconciling on Monday because the cached sync token expired while crews were out of coverage. Surveys queued locally are intact, but uploads fail silently until re-auth. We've extended token lifetime to 30 days and reissued credentials. The replacement key for the internal sync service follows.

service key, fafog-fahaf: vxb3-x55

- [ ] Key ceremony item 4: Tilegrove prefetcher signing key. As the new contractor, confirm the prefetcher's regional tile manifests are checksummed before the key is generated. Two witnesses must observe the ceremony and sign the log. Once the key material is sealed into the offline enclave, store the hardware token in the Fernhollow cabinet. Unsealing later requires the recovery passphrase noted directly below.

vault phrase of yagag-kadup = belael-druius-rusax-kelox